Understanding Water Quality Issues in Meadow Vista, CA

Meadow Vista residents often face common water problems such as hardness, iron, sulfur odors, and staining. These issues stem from the local groundwater composition, which can contain elevated levels of minerals like calcium, magnesium, and iron. Hard water leads to scale buildup on pipes and appliances, while iron and sulfur can cause unpleasant odors and reddish or yellow stains on fixtures and laundry.

Why Water Softener Sizing Matters for Meadow Vista Homeowners

Choosing the correct water softener size is crucial to effectively address these water quality challenges. An undersized system may fail to remove enough minerals, leaving you with ongoing scale, stains, and odors. Conversely, an oversized system can waste salt, water, and energy, increasing operating costs unnecessarily.

Proper sizing ensures your system can handle your household's water usage and mineral content, providing efficient treatment and long-lasting protection for your plumbing and appliances.

Factors to Consider When Sizing Your Water Softener

  • Water Hardness Level: Measure the grains per gallon (GPG) of hardness in your water to determine how much mineral content needs removal.
  • Household Water Usage: Estimate daily water consumption based on the number of occupants and typical usage patterns.
  • Iron and Sulfur Concentrations: High iron or sulfur levels may require specialized treatment or a larger softener capacity.
  • Flow Rate: Consider peak water usage times to ensure the softener can handle the demand without pressure drops.
